HUD Subsidized Apartments: Catering to Low-Income Individuals This apartment complex gladly accepts Housing and Urban Development (HUD) subsidies. If you meet the criteria for low-income housing and there are available units, you can expect your rent to be based on a reasonable 30% of your Adjusted Gross Income.
